well you need to change the temp sensor on engine. and that will tell ecm engine is running warm enought to use overdrive. when engine to cold it doesn't allow overdrive to work to keep rpm's up to warm engine.as for the code 12 don't worry about that it just means you battery at one time was either discontected or dead and it sets that code.

i guess i should have asked this befor hand those trouble codes you listed where they pulled out from the check engine light or using a scan tool and pulled for tcm(trans control mod)?? if engine light then codes are as i posted if from tcm the code 17 is an internal tcm failure and the tcm needs to be replaced. But your really going to need to go get the codes pulled out from tcm to really determine the prob with trans as most of the codes the engine light gives you are just for engine not trans.
